发明名称 Method for producing reinforcement elements from fibre-reinforced plastic
摘要 A method for manufacturing a reinforcing member (2) consisting of fiber-reinforced plastic for mineral construction materials, in particular for concrete. In the method, curing the composite fiber rod (1) takes place in at least three stages (7, 16, 25) sequencing one after another, wherein after the first stage of curing (7) at least one radiation-reflecting and/or thermally-insulating covering agent (15) is applied onto the pre-cured composite fiber rod (1), wherein a second stage of curing (16) of the composite fiber rod (1), together with the covering agent(s) (15) applied is executed, in which the composite fiber rod (1) is further cured in the regions (14) not covered by the covering agents (15) by the supply of heat and/or radiation, and wherein the deformation (23) of the composite fiber rod (1) is executed between the second stage of curing (16) and the final stage of curing (25).

A method for the manufacture of a reinforcing member (2) consisting of fibre-reinforced plastic for mineral construction materials, in particular for concrete, comprising the following steps: a multiplicity of fibres (3) is impregnated with plastic, the fibres (5b) enclosed by plastic are pre-cured in a first stage of curing (7) by the supply of heat and/or radiation to form a composite fibre rod (1), if necessary, the composite fibre rod (1) is cut to the length that is desired for the reinforcing member (2), the pre-cured composite fibre rod (1) is brought into a shape desired for the reinforcing member (2), the composite fibre rod (1) is cured in a final stage of curing (25) by the supply of heat and/or radiation,characterised in thatthe curing of the composite fibre rod (1) takes place in at least three stages of curing (7, 16, 25) sequencing one after another,in that after the first stage of curing (7) at least one radiation-reflecting and/or thermally-insulating covering agent (15) is applied onto the pre-cured composite fibre rod (1), over at least one individual section (13) of the composite fibre rod (1), which covering agent covers the composite fibre rod (1) on the said at least one section (13) over at least a part of its periphery, wherein a second stage of curing (16) of the composite fibre rod (1), together with the covering agent(s) (15) applied on some sections, is executed, in which the composite fibre rod (1) is further cured in the regions (14) not covered by the covering agents (15) by the supply of heat and/or radiation, and in that the deformation (23) of the composite fibre rod (1) is executed between the second stage of curing (16) and the final stage of curing (25).
